Reader initialization
Some RFID readers must be initialized during initial start-up.
6.7.1
LEGIC
LEGIC readers require a reader launch in certain cases:
•
If a read-protected segment is to be used.
•
If writing to a write-protected segment is to be done, for example during a CardLink ap-
plication.
Reader launch
ü
The reader launch requires an SAM 63 card (security card C2) containing the correspond-
ing segment area.
1.
Hold the SAM 63 card in front of the reader if the device expects an RFID input in normal
operation.
ð
The start of the sequence is confirmed by means of an acoustic signal.
ð
Three successive acoustic signals are output if the process cannot be executed, for ex-
ample if the reader has already been launched.
2.
The SAM 63 card must be present uninterruptedly in the reading area for about 15-20
seconds.
ð
After a successful launch, 3 short acoustic signals are output.
ð
Eight successive signals are output when an error occurs.
3.
Remove the SAM 63 card from the field.
Reader delaunch
ü
The reader is delaunched using an SAM 64 card.
1.
Hold the SAM 64 card in front of the reader if the device expects an RFID input in normal
operation.
ð
The start of the sequence is confirmed by means of an acoustic signal.
ð
Three successive acoustic signals are output if the process cannot be executed, for ex-
ample if the reader has already been launched.
2.
The SAM 64 card must be present uninterruptedly in the reading area for about 15-20
seconds.
ð
After a successful delaunch, 3 short acoustic signals are output.
ð
Eight successive signals are output when an error occurs.
3.
Remove the SAM 64 card from the field.
